Class: Spirillinata    Subclass: Ammodiscana    Order: Spirillinida    Family: Ammodiscidae
Glomospira charoides (Jones and Parker, 1860)
     Morphological Attributes:
Wallmaterial: agglutinated
Overall appearance: globose to ovate
Coiling: tubular enrolled
Chamberform: tubular
Aperture Position: terminal
Aperture Form: round oval reniform, --, --, --
Sutures: depressed, curved, --
Ornamentation: --, --, --, --
